Added a LazyIndex subclass, as well as some test cases to make sure it does lazy things.

It avoids reading in entire index files if they are greater than 125kb in size and not inline.

No idea if this is how HG does it but it seems OK to me for now.

Amp aims to put control of version-control software in your hands as a developer. The entire system is written in Ruby (with C extensions to improve performance), and aims to implement all major VCS's in Ruby. Currently, Mercurial is implemented.

Other features:
Commands are first-class members of the system - drop in an "Ampfile" in your repository, and you can add commands to amp in the same manner you add commands to rake (only with far, far more power!)
Documentation is one of our biggest priorities. We require all methods to be documented - even comically simple ones.
Heavy testing.
Multiple "workflows" - use git's commands to power a mercurial repository.
Add hooks/callbacks in minutes.
